2012 Events / Schedule

To celebrate 20 years of our International Week of Prayer and Fasting, we’ve extended the length. There will be an eighteen-day period, consisting of two novenas, nine days each.

The first novena will be to petition for God’s Mercy on our world, our country, our leaders, our families, our youth, our children and the unborn.

The second novena will be in thanksgiving for hearing and answering our prayers.

 

Eucharistic Prayer Vigil – “Imploring God’s Mercy”

Saturday, October 20th, 2012

9am–4pm (Mass @ Noon)

Basilica of the National Shrine of the Immaculate Conception

400 Michigan Ave., NE — Washington, DC 20017

This Year’s Speakers Include…


Bishop George Nkuo | The Most Reverend George Nkuo is the bishop of Kumbo Cameroon, Africa.  He is an educator by training and became Bishop on July 8, 2006.  Bishop George Nkuo is from a family of five children.  He is the oldest son.  His older sister, who is the eldest in the family, is a Franciscan sister in Shisong, Cameroon.

Dr. Richard L. Russell |   Richard L. Russell is Catholic convert and an accomplished international relations scholar.  He blends his faith and reason to research, write, and lecture about the 20th Century Marian apparitions in Amsterdam, The Netherlands, called the “Lady of All Nations.”  His article “Messages on War and Peace from the Lady of All Nations” appeared in the magazine Missio Immaculatae, published by the Franciscan Friars of the Immaculate, in the summer 2011.

Russell’s career blends scholarship with national security practice.  He holds a Ph.D. in Foreign Affairs from the University of Virginia.  Russell has held research appointments with the Miller Center of Public Affairs at the University of Virginia and the Institute for the Study of Diplomacy at Georgetown University.  He taught for nearly ten years graduate courses on international security, grand strategy, and military operations for Georgetown University’s Security Studies Program.  Russell also served for seventeen years as a political-military analyst on the Middle East and Europe for the Central Intelligence Agency.

He is the author of three books: Sharpening Strategic Intelligence: Why the CIA Gets It Wrong and What Needs to be Done to Get It Right (Cambridge University Press, 2007); Weapons Proliferation and War in the Greater Middle East (Routledge, 2005); and, George F. Kennan’s Strategic Thought (Praeger, 1999).   He has published about thirty journal and magazine articles and fifteen chapters in edited books.

Russell’s expertise has been cited in leading newspapers and magazines to include the Christian Science Monitor, Los Angeles Times, New York Times, Washington Post, USA Today, The New Republic, and The Weekly Standard.  His opinions and editorials have appeared in Commentary, Foreign Affairs, Foreign Policy, The Economist and The Wall Street Journal.  He has been interviewed by EWTN World Over, Al Jazeera, ABC News, BBC Radio, CNN, National Public Radio, and Voice of America. Russell lives with his Dutch wife and two sons in Tampa, Florida.

 

Fr. Chad Partain | Father Partain is from the diocese of Alexandria, LA and is a priest on a mission.  He is the driving force behind the St. Philomena Youth for Purity Program and the re-establishment of the Children of Mary movement. As a young boy, he was healed through the intercession of St. Philomena and promised to spread devotion to this wonder-working Saint.

 

 

Vicki Thorn | Foundress of Project Rachel and the executive director of the National Office of Post-Abortion Reconciliation & Healing. Recently, she has been doing presentations to high school groups, college students and adult groups on her recent research on the Biology of the Theology of the Body.

Monsignor Charles Pope | Msgr. Charles Pope is the pastor of Holy Comforter-St. Cyprian, a vibrant parish community in Washington, DC. A native of Chicago with a bachelor degree in computer science, his interest in the priesthood stemmed from his experience as a church musician. He attended Mount Saint Mary’s Seminary and was ordained in 1989. A pastor since 2000, he also has led Bible studies in the U.S. Congress and at the White House in past years.

 

Ted Flynn | Author of best selling book on the political philosophy of the new world order, Hope of the Wicked: The Master Plan to Rule the World, and co-author of the best selling book on Marian apparitions, The Thunder of Justice.  He has traveled to over 50 countries and has given many talks on radio, TV and conferences globally.
